The 3 months correlation between Msift and Nuveen is 0.45.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Msift High Yield and Nuveen California High in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Nuveen California High and Msift High is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Msift High Yield are associated (or correlated) with Nuveen California.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Nuveen California High has no effect on the direction of Msift High i.e., Msift High and Nuveen California go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Msift High and Nuveen California
The main advantage of trading using opposite Msift High and Nuveen California posit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Msift High position performs unexpectedly, Nuveen California can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
